Definition

Violent attacks, usually organized or allowed by authorities, targeting a specific ethnic or religious group, especially Jews. Often involving destruction, killing, and forced displacement.

Usage & Nuances

"Pogroms" is used mainly in historical or academic contexts, especially about violence against Jews in Eastern Europe in the late 19th and early 20th centuries. Always plural when referring to historical events. The word implies state or community complicity.
